Sony out with Xperia new Series with X and XA

Sony after so long has unveiled its all new “X” series smartphones with the launch of – XperiaTM X and XperiaTM XA. These smartphones are designed to give some premium feel to the consumers. The Xperia X Dual (seen below) has been priced at Rs. 48,990, and will be available from June 7; while the Xperia XA Dual has been priced at Rs. 20,990, and will be available from the third week of June.

The two Xperia X-Series smartphones have gone up for pre-booking via the Amazon.com, and authorised Sony retailers across the country.

When we come to the overall specs of both Xperia X Dual and Xperoa XA Dual smartphones. They run on Android 6.0 Marshmallow with company’s UI on top of it. Sony Xperia X Dual features a 5-inch full-HD (1080×1920 pixels). It also comes with a 23-megapixel rear camera with an f/2.0 aperture and pulse LED flash, 13-megapixel front camera with an f/2.0 aperture; 3GB of RAM; 32GB inbuilt storage, expandable storage support up to 200GB via microSD card, and 4G LTE support. The Xperia X Dual packs a Qualcomm Snapdragon 650 processor. The Sony Xperia X measures 142.7×69.4×7.9mm and weighs 153 grams. It is backed by a 2620mAh battery. The handset’s dual-SIM version packs 64GB inbuilt storage

Xperia-XAtechniblogic

Where as, Xperia XA Dual features a 5-inch HD (720×1280 pixels) display powered by Mobile Bravia engine 2. It is powered by a MediaTek MT6755 coupled with 2GB of RAM and 16GB of built-in storage. Like the Xperia X, the Xperia XA Dual also supports expandable storage via microSD card (up to 200GB). The Android 6.0 Marshmallow smartphone sports a 13-megapixel camera with Exmor RS for mobile sensor, hybrid autofocus, and LED flash. It also houses an 8-megapixel front camera. It is backed by a 2300mAh battery, measures 143.6×66.8×7.9mm, and weighs 138 grams.
